Key
Purpose:
To support and deliver high standards of rugby training sessions, attend fixtures, and implement individual development plans for all players.
Bath College is an inclusive education and training community, providing learning for people with a wide range of abilities from a far-reaching area, from entry level to Level 5 programmes. We are committed to meeting the needs of all our students. This is a very exciting time to join the College.
Key Responsibilities Coaching & Programme Delivery- Plan, lead and deliver high-quality rugby coaching sessions aligned with RFU principles, developing technical, tactical, physical, and psychosocial aspects of performance.
- Deliver sessions in line with long‑term player development models and ensure a positive, inclusive learning environment.
- Coach on match days and provide appropriate feedback to players.
- Evaluate coaching sessions to ensure continuous improvement and inclusivity.
- Prepare and manage matchday logistics including fixtures, kit, and equipment.
- Submit fixture results and player data in line with league or competition requirements.
- Write short match reports for marketing and promotion purposes.
- Support coaching delivery within the Bath Rugby Academy as directed by the Head of Academy (Bath Rugby) and Director of Sports Academies (Bath College).
